Description
Morris speaks about the pending 2004 election. Framing it by saying America is not polarized on individual issues--citing overwhelming approval of Bush on fighting terrorism and Kerry on the environment--he believes the election will be if America wants a war-time president, Bush, or peace-time president, Kerry. Saying that Bush is better at fighting terrorism than Clinton was, he segues into the war on terrorism, saying the war in Iraq is part of that. In the process, he touches on corruption at the United Nations.
